Post XD Speedometer Not Correct

Hello I'm new to the forum life so please fogive me if this is posted in the wrong area....... I own a 2010 Xd 5Speed and i just got back from a road trip of 1,600 miles and the problem im having is that my speedometer is not correct with the speed im going, I noticed this once i got off the highway and was cruzing at 55, when my speed reads 40mph im actually doing 30mph and 55mph needs to read 65 etc. so my tac is off by 10mph. Any help would be greatly appreciated letting me know what could be the issue with this. Im just really puzzled as i haven't had any issue with my Xd at all... Thanks ......
